Risks and Complications of Penis Fillers | Moorgate Andrology
Penis enlargement with hyaluronic acid fillers is a popular non-surgical option for enhancing penile girth. While generally safe when performed by qualified professionals, it's essential to be aware of potential risks and complications.
Common Side Effects
-
Bruising, Swelling, and Redness: These are typical after injectable treatments and usually subside within a few days.
-
Pain: Mild soreness may occur initially. Over-the-counter pain relievers like paracetamol can help. Contact your healthcare provider if pain persists or worsens.
-
Infection: Although rare, infections can develop within the first few days post-treatment. Symptoms include swelling, tenderness, and discharge. Seek medical attention promptly if these occur.
Less Common Complications
-
Lumps and Bumps: Small nodules may form under the skin. Post-treatment massage can help, but if they persist, treatments like hyaluronidase injections may be necessary. In uncircumcised men, filler migration to the tip of the penis can occur, potentially affecting foreskin retraction.
-
Hypersensitivity Reactions: Localized swelling and redness can happen, typically resolving with conservative management.
-
Granulomas: These are firm, red lumps resulting from immune responses to the filler. Treatment options include hyaluronidase injections.
-
Vascular Occlusion: A rare but serious complication where filler enters a blood vessel, leading to tissue ischemia. Symptoms include severe swelling and pain. Immediate medical intervention is required.
Rare and Severe Complications
-
Necrosis: Death of tissue due to compromised blood supply. This requires urgent medical attention and may necessitate surgical intervention.
-
Keloid Scarring: Excessive scar tissue formation, leading to raised, thickened scars. Management may involve corticosteroid injections or surgical revision.
